Key Factors That Influence Electronic Key Management System Price

When requesting quotations for key tracking infrastructure, it is important to realize that there is no one-size-fits-all cost. The overall electronic key management system price varies depending on hardware specifications, scale, and software deployment models. Understanding these variables ensures your procurement team avoids overpaying for unnecessary features while securing a solution that scales smoothly.

1. Hardware Capacity and Slot Density

The most direct factor impacting the electronic key management system price is the physical capacity of the cabinet unit. Basic wall-mounted cabinets designed for small offices hold between 10 to 20 key positions, offering an entry-level cost point. Conversely, enterprise-grade, heavy-duty steel cabinets built for large-scale operations—capable of housing 100+ key slots with individual electronic locking pegs—command a higher initial hardware investment.

2. Authentication Hardware & Biometric Technology

The access interface on the cabinet itself plays a significant role in determining the total electronic key management system price. Basic configurations utilize numerical keypads or standard proximity RFID badge readers. Upgrading to advanced multi-factor authentication—such as facial recognition, optical fingerprint scanners, or encrypted mobile smartphone credentials—adds to the upfront unit cost but drastically raises the security threshold.

3. Cloud Software Licensing vs. On-Premise Hosting

Software architecture is another core component of the true electronic key management system price. Many modern platforms utilize a Software-as-a-Service (SaaS) model, which reduces initial capital expenditure (CapEx) in favor of predictable monthly or annual cloud subscription fees. Cloud hosting provides remote access dashboards, automatic software updates, and mobile alerts. Alternatively, self-hosted on-premise software requires a larger initial license investment but avoids recurring subscription fees.

Calculating the ROI of an Intelligent Key Management System

When assessing the upfront electronic key management system price, smart business leads look at the broader picture: the cost of inaction. Legacy key management relies on manual logbooks, which create significant, hidden operational costs over time.

Deploying an automated intelligent key management system delivers immediate cost offsets across several core areas:

  • Eliminating Re-Keying Expenses: Losing a facility master key requires replacing lock cylinders across dozens of doors. A single lost master key incident can cost thousands of pounds or dollars in locksmith labor alone. An automated cabinet locks down high-security keys, eliminating lost-key risks.
  • Saving Administrative Hours: Operations leads waste hundreds of hours each year tracking down misplaced vehicle keys or chasing contractors for unreturned access fobs. An intelligent key management system automates the entire sign-out and sign-in lifecycle, saving valuable payroll hours.
  • Preventing Internal Asset Loss: When tools, vehicles, or equipment go missing, manual logs rarely provide clear accountability. An intelligent key management system maintains an unalterable digital audit trail linking every key removal to a verified user profile.

Core Commercial Features to Prioritize

To ensure you get maximum value for your electronic key management system price, prioritize platforms that offer these essential operational capabilities:

Modular System Expansion

Your physical security infrastructure should grow alongside your enterprise. A modular intelligent key management system allows you to start with a single master cabinet unit and daisy-chain additional expansion bays as your property portfolio or fleet grows, preserving your original hardware investment.

Open API Architecture & Software Integrations

A siloed asset tracking system creates administrative friction. High-performance software platforms offer open APIs that integrate smoothly into your existing management stack:

  • Property Management Systems (PMS): Automatically provision temporary access PINs for contractors or maintenance staff.
  • Active Directory & HR Portals: Automatically update user permissions, revoking key access instantly when an employee leaves the company.

Custom Time-Restricted Access Schedules

An advanced intelligent key management system allows administrators to program dynamic access windows. For example, a third-party cleaning crew can be granted access to specific keys only between 6:00 PM and 10:00 PM on weekdays, keeping the assets locked outside of those exact hours.
